The area of a square can be found using the equation A = s², where A is the area and s is the measure of one side of the square.

Match the equation for how to solve for the side length of a square to its description.

Answer: s = √A

Explanation:

Hi, to answer this question we have to solve the equation given for s.

A = s²

Extracting square root from both sides:

√A=√ (s²)

√A=s

Son, in conclusion, the equation for solving the side length of the square it equal to:

s = √A
